As soon as you've decided to replace your door windows, the next step is picking the ideal materials. Each product has its own set of advantages and drawbacks:
Vinyl:
Benefits: Low upkeep, energy-efficient, and relatively economical.Disadvantages: May not be as long lasting as other products and can fade gradually.
Wood:
Benefits: Traditional and stylish, offers excellent insulation, and can be stained or painted to match any decoration.Disadvantages: Requires routine upkeep, such as sealing and painting, and can be more expensive than other alternatives.
Aluminum:
Benefits: Durable, corrosion-resistant, and lightweight. Perfect for contemporary designs.Downsides: Not as energy-efficient as wood or vinyl, and can be prone to thermal bridging.
Fiberglass:
Benefits: Extremely durable, energy-efficient, and can imitate the appearance of wood without the upkeep.Downsides: More expensive than vinyl or aluminum, and can be much heavier to set up.Picking the Right Type of Window

Replacing door windows can be an intricate job, specifically if you're not experienced. Here's a detailed guide to help you through the procedure:
Measure the Opening:
Step: Accurately measure the height, width, and depth of the window opening. This will guarantee that the new window fits perfectly.
Remove the Old Window:
Step: Carefully get rid of the old window, keeping in mind of any damage to the frame or surrounding area that may require repair.
Prepare the Opening:
Step: Clean the opening and repair any broken locations. This might include getting rid of old caulk and filling out gaps.
Install the New Window:
Step: Place the brand-new window in the opening, ensuring it is level and plumb. Protect it with screws or nails, as defined by the producer.
Seal the Edges:
Step: Apply a top quality caulk around the edges to seal any gaps and prevent drafts or water infiltration.
Last Touches:
Step: Install any trim or molding and make sure the window operates smoothly if it is an operable panel.Employing a Professional

Q: How long does it require to replace a door window?
A: The time it requires to replace a door window can vary depending upon the intricacy of the task. Easy replacements can take a couple of hours, while more comprehensive projects may take a day or 2.
Q: Can I replace a door window myself?
A: While it's possible to replace a door window yourself, it can be a tough task, especially if the window is large or if the frame is harmed. It's typically advised to hire a professional to ensure the task is done correctly and securely.
Q: How much does door window replacement cost?

Q: Are energy-efficient windows worth the investment?
A: Yes, energy-efficient windows can considerably lower your energy expenses and enhance the comfort of your home. They are especially advantageous in locations with severe weather condition conditions.
Q: What should I try to find in a window guarantee?
A: A good window warranty should cover both the products and the setup. Search for a service warranty that lasts at least 10-15 years and covers problems and damage.Upkeep Tips for New Door Windows
